Translation templates build gets wrong branch URL

Bug #537866 reported by Jeroen T. Vermeulen on 2010-03-12
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Launchpad itself
Jeroen T. Vermeulen

Bug Description

wgrant noticed that TranslationTemplatesBuildBehavior.dispatchBuildToSlave re-computes the branch_url argument passed to the slave, using IBranch.url instead of IBranch.composePublicURL which was specifically created for this.

To fix this, it would be enough to pass the TranslationTemplatesBuildJob's metadata to the slave as arguments, instead of re-computing them.

Related branches

Jeroen T. Vermeulen (jtv) wrote :

Shamelessly lumping in an unrelated issue: TranslationTemplatesBuildBehavior should override verifySlaveBuildID to accept the type of id strings generated by TranslationTemplatesBuildJob.getName.

Of the base verifySlaveBuildID, the part that checks the BuildQueue is generically useful so that should probably become a helper.

Changed in rosetta:
status: In Progress → Fix Committed
tags: added: qa-needstesting
tags: added: qa-ok
removed: qa-needstesting
Changed in rosetta: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ers